Can the NVIDIA RTX 4090 run Final Fantasy XVI? (2026)

Yes
~80 FPS at 4K with optimized settings

The NVIDIA RTX 4090 is a flagship 4K-class card with 24GB of VRAM, and Final Fantasy XVI is a one of the most punishing games to run on PC. Paired with a balanced Intel Core i9-14900K-class CPU it averages about 80 FPS at 4K with FrameCoach's tuned settings — up from roughly 59 FPS with everything on High.

ResolutionAll-High FPSOptimized FPS
1080p173173
1440p104104
4K5980
🚀 Biggest free win: enable DLSS (Quality) — about +35% FPS for a small sharpness trade.

At 1080p expect around 173 FPS, at 1440p about 104 FPS, and at 4K roughly 80 FPS with optimized settings. Its 24GB of VRAM is plenty for Final Fantasy XVI. The single biggest improvement is DLSS upscaling — set it to Quality.
